The surrounding area offers an array of attractions, with Cheltenham being a short distance away. Known as 'The Western Gateway to the Cotswolds', Cheltenham is celebrated for its Regency architecture, annual festivals, and vibrant arts scene. Visitors can explore the town's rich history, including landmarks like the Pittville Pump Room and the Everyman Theatre, or partake in the renowned Cheltenham Festival, a premier horse racing event. Families can also enjoy nearby attractions such as the Cotswold Motoring Museum and Birdland Park and Gardens, making Willow Cottage a perfect base for exploring the enchanting Cotswolds region.
